Understanding Stress And Burnout: Symptoms, Identification, And Support

Many people confuse short-term pressure with a deep, chronic state of exhaustion. Learning to differentiate the two is the first step to protecting your mental health. While temporary stress is a normal response that motivates us to do tasks, long-term and unmanaged stress can turn into burnout.

Caregiver Burnout: Recognizing The Signs And Taking Action

Providing care for a loved one can be a deeply rewarding experience, but the relentless emotional and physical demands can take a heavy toll. When the stress of caregiving exceeds one's coping resources, a serious condition known as caregiver burnout can develop.

Reprocessing the Past: How EMDR Therapy Supports Emotional Healing

Past emotionally charged experiences can sometimes interfere with the brain’s natural ability to update memories with present-day information. Instead of feeling like something that happened long ago, these experiences may continue to show up as distressing emotions, vivid images, or physical reactions that feel immediate and overwhelming.
